A college student wakes up and notices a racing heart and dilated pupils. The student is scheduled to write an exam later that m
kozerog [31]

Answer:

Sympathetic nervous system

Explanation:

Under stress conditions, the sympathetic division of the autonomic nervous system prepares the body by exhibiting flight or fight response. It includes some physiological changes in the body during stress conditions such as before and during exams.

Some of the physiological responses of the sympathetic nervous system are rapidly pounding, dilated pupils of eyes, deep breathing, dry mouth, and sweaty skin. It also shunts the blood circulation towards active skeletal and cardiac muscles. Dilation of bronchioles to increase ventilation to facilitate the delivery of more oxygen to the body cell is another change stimulated by the sympathetic nervous system. Therefore, the mentioned responses are due to the activation of the sympathetic nervous system of the student since he is in the stress of the exam.

The rate of firing of the postsynaptic neuron depends on the amount of ______ input it receives from the presynaptic neuron.
AysviL [449]

The postsynaptic potential is the membrane potential, which takes place in the neuron present post synapsis (after the chemical synapse). The presynaptic neuron releases neurotransmitter, which causes the firing in the postsynaptic neurons.  

The firing of the post synaptic neuron depends on the excitation and inhibition inputs received from the presynaptic neuron. The firing is the resultant of the summation of excitatory and inhibitory potential. In case, the excitatory potential is greater than inhibitory potential, the post synaptic neuron would be excited. in case, inhibitory potential is greater than excitatory potential, then the post synaptic neuron would be inhibited.
